Ruhrpumpen

VCT (Models: HX, KX, MX, RX, SX, TR, VMF, VX, WX)

Ruhrpumpen VCT (Models: HX, KX, MX, RX, SX, TR, VMF, VX, WX) — Seawater lift, cooling water, crude handling, general offshore, water injection, circulating water.

Components & Design

Component data being added…

Technical Data

Type Vertical circulating mixed/radial flow pump, single/multi-stage
Capacity Up to 45,000 m³/h (200,000 U.S. gpm)
Head 24-42 m (18-40 ft) typical
Max Pressure 20 bar (285 psi)
Temperature Range -30°C to +135°C (-20°F to 275°F)
Standards API 610 VS1 type, DNV Marine Certified

Common failures & inspection points

Cavitation damage (pitting, hammered surface, material loss on impeller inlet edges)

Visually inspect impeller surfaces, vane edges, and pump casing for pitting patterns, erosion texture, or material loss; check suction pressure/NPSH margin; listen for gravel-like noise during operation

Mechanical seal degradation and leakage (external seal chamber weeping, internal bypass, thermal runaway)

Monitor seal chamber for continuous dripping vs. normal steady drips (packed pumps); check seal temperature on casing surface; inspect gland chamber for pitting, cracks, erosion, or corrosion; verify seal lubrication state during maintenance

Bearing wear and high-frequency vibration (squealing, grinding, heat generation, increased clearance)

Monthly: record bearing temperature and compare to baseline; listen for squeals/grinding sounds; monitor coupling alignment; test motor insulation resistance; check foundation bolt torque; verify lubricant color and viscosity for water contamination

Valve leakage in discharge/suction manifolds (pressure loss, broad-banded noise 3-12.5 kHz, backflow in single-direction check valves)

Compare discharge pressure trend to baseline at fixed capacity; remove and visually inspect suction/discharge valve inserts for wear/cracks/erosion; inspect valve seat faces for pitting; monitor for 30 dB noise increase on accelerometer; test check valve one-way flow integrity

Impeller wear, imbalance, and hydraulic instability (irregular wear pattern, thrust bearing damage, motor current spike)

Inspect wear rings for damage and replace if necessary; examine impeller and casing wear patterns for symmetry issues; monitor motor current draw vs. baseline; check shaft straightness and coupling alignment; verify pump operates within rated capacity range

Type-general inspection and maintenance points for this equipment category — not model-specific.
